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
50862920 50543769559 82
73463 9621 01976689998
73463 9621 01976689998
671 013897837 18 1321128
All about undefined
Interested in learning more?
73463 9621 01976689998
671 013897837 18 1321128
See more
1443872401 22023117493
460966 206 2016108198 118620035
See more
16448 8678712
88 2494390995 92212427
See more